dc.description.abstractThis work presents the development and validation of the K0- WEB software, dedicated to the determination of elemental concentrations based on the k₀-standardization method of Neutron Activation Analysis (NAA). This method, recognized for its high accuracy, enables multielement analyses of samples without the need for standards, relying on the precise characterization of facilities and the use of nuclear parameters such as k0- factors, Q₀, and decay constants. The system stands out for its innovative web-based architecture and the automation of nuclear data import, providing originality and operational autonomy. The software integrates essential corrections—such as cascade summing, geometry factor, and allows step-by-step monitoring of calculations, interactive visualization, and report generation. The validation of K0-WEB was carried out by comparing its results with those of the K0-IPEN program, previously submitted to an international intercomparison exercise of the International Atomic Energy Agency (IAEA), ensuring the reliability of the new system. The experimental part employed standardized data from IAEA-TECDOC-2026. Concentration, efficiency, and thermal and epithermal flux parameter calculations were performed according to methodologies established in the literature, with emphasis on the bare triple monitor method and the cadmium ratio method. Additionally, an uncertainty analysis based on error propagation and covariance matrix was applied. The results demonstrated the validation of K0-WEB, and it can be concluded that K0-WEB represents an innovative, accurate, and efficient solution for application in NAA laboratories.
